Hello all! I have a Pioneer 1000 that I am going to use for snow plowing. The original lights are fine for me when I am trail riding at night. However, when I raise the snow plow, the blade will block my headlights. I am wanting to get a light bar to use when I am plowing snow. I was wondering what light bar you guys would recommend, and also the location to mount it. I am considering at the top of my windshield, or at the bottom of my windshield, or out on the top of the bumper.. Any info or recommendations will be greatly appreciated. Thank you in advance.

I've got a 52" curved light bar on top of my brush guard. I preferred that for personal reasons.

I've had light bars on my trucks at the edge of the roof/windshield and I really didn't like the light spillage back in thru the windshield and down on the dash an into the cab.

Many have that setup on their Pioneers and seem to have no problem.
